Peppa and her friends are having an arts and crafts day at playgroup. They start by finger painting and then move on to face painting. Madame Gazelle, their teacher, sets up a big canvas where they splatter paint to create a unique picture. After removing the tape, the painting takes the shape of a star. Later, Peppa and Rebecca Rabbit build a pillow fort and decorate it. Finally, they enjoy some snacks inside the fort.
